Abstract

Porcelain laminate veneers were first introduced by Charles Pinacus in 1930 s. Since then gained popularity in the field of esthetic dentistry because of the optimal esthetics, minimal preparation and durability. The advancement in dental adhesives also contributed the successes of ceramic laminates. This article highlights the improved esthetics of a patient who came with a complaint of discolored teeth, restoring them with ceramic veneers
